  • 21 Jun 2008
    First fruitings. Yay! Yellow Squash Harvesting and Missy and Tripp Season 2008 garden
    We were able to harvest a few squash from the plants this weekend. They are doing great with no problems and the fruitings look great. I can’t wait to cook them this week.

  • 14 Jun 2008
    Trellised Pole Beans and Missy and Tripp Season 2008 garden
    I built a small trellis for the pole beans the other day. I used some old limbs from a plant Tripp trimmed in early spring. The beans are finally having a growth spurt and they are beginning to find the trellis. It’s strange how they reach and latch on.
